Must Have | TOP 100 | Authors | Reviews | RSS | Submit

Recommended Software

WinRAR

WinRAR 3.90

WinRAR is a 32-bit/64-bit Windows version of RAR Archiver, the powerful archiver and archive manager. WinRARs main features are very strong general and multimedia compression, solid compression, archive protection from damage, processing of ZIP and other non-RAR archives, scanning archives for...

DOWNLOAD
 
 

xFunction for Windows

xFunction for Windows 2.16

Category: Developer Tools / Components & Libraries | Author: Excelsior, LLC

Java library for interfacing to external functions written in any programming language. Surpasses JNI in ease of use and other aspects. Ideal solution for reuse of legacy code and non-Java third party libraries.

DOWNLOAD GET FULL VER Cost: $50.00 USD
License: Shareware
Size: 176.6 KB
Download Counter: 5

The xFunction library is the universal solution for integration of Java code with code written in other languages, superior in many aspects to Java Native Interface (JNI). With xFunction, you no longer need to implement those ugly native methods. Instead, you extend and instantiate xFunction classes to create conventional Java objects representing external functions, data structures, pointers, and callbacks. All necessary data conversions and external function calls are done seamlessly by the xFunction library. Using xFunction, you may invoke any operating system API call or function from any DLL or shared library in a natural and convenient manner. xFunction allows you to achieve the highest levels of code reuse without translating any source code to Java and/or writing cumbersome JNI wrappers.

Requirements: J2SE 1.3 or above
OS Support: Windows 95, Windows 98, Windows Me, Windows NT, Windows 2000, Windows XP
Language Support: English

Released: July 25, 2005 | Added: July 28, 2005 | Viewed: 1323
 

Related Software

Bar Code Library | Code Library Tool | Code Reuse | Dll | External Function | Function Library | Id3 java code | Java | Java Library | Java Pdf Library | Jni | Native Method | Shared Library | Source Code Library

  • No Icon xFunction for Linux - Java library for interfacing to external functions written in any programming language. Surpasses JNI in ease of use and other aspects. Ideal solution for reuse of legacy code and non-Java third party libraries.
  • No Icon xFunction for Mac OS X - Java library for interfacing to external functions written in any programming language. Surpasses JNI in ease of use and other aspects. Ideal solution for reuse of legacy code and non-Java third party libraries.
  • No Icon J2Native - Software development kit for working with native code from any Java application without using Java Native Interface (JNI) technology. You can call functions from any dynamic library or use system API without necessity to waste time on studying JNI.
  • JNC - JavaNativeCompiler Icon JNC - JavaNativeCompiler - JNC is a Java to native compiler. It allows AOT (ahead of time) compilation of your Java applications. With JNC, you can create real standalone native binaries (.exe on Windows) which will no longer depend on a JRE.
  • SimpleIPC Icon SimpleIPC - SimpleIPC is a development platform which allows you to have some of your application's work performed in an external process. If there is a process crash, it will be one of the external processes, rather than your app. SimpleIPC uses .NET Remoting.
  • No Icon EasyCharts - EasyCharts is a complete library of java charting components, applets, and servlets, that enable programmers to add charts and graphs in java and web applications with just a few lines of code.
  • JEXECreator Icon JEXECreator - Create a native Windows EXE to launch your Java application! The native launcher finds a suitable Java?„? Runtime Environment and starts your Java application using the found JRE.
  • JCGO Icon JCGO - JCGO is a software product which translates (converts) programs written in Java into platform-independent C code, which could, further, be compiled (by third-party tools) into highly-optimized native code for the target platform and deployed.
  • Excelsior JET for Windows Icon Excelsior JET for Windows - Excelsior JET is a complete solution for acceleration, protection and deployment of your Java(tm) applications, certified Java Compatible on a number of Microsoft Windows and Linux (IA-32) platforms.
  • Excelsior JET for Linux Icon Excelsior JET for Linux - Excelsior JET is a complete solution for acceleration, protection and deployment of your Java(tm) applications, certified Java Compatible on a number of Microsoft Windows and Linux (IA-32) platforms.
 

Actual Software | Link To Us | Links | Contact

Must Have | TOP 100 | Authors | Reviews | RSS | Submit